After a Twitter conversation with local foodniks turned into “Hey, why doesn’t Posh step up and serve a late-night industry menu on Thursdays,” chef-owner Joshua Hebert met the challenge.
Why Thursday? Well, there are already late-night options on Friday and Saturday.
Last week was the debut, and I stopped by for some ridiculously good boar bacon (pictured above), served with asparagus and a tiny sunny-side-up quail egg. The so-called bacon had a mouthwatering smokiness, but this was no crispy, fatty little slab o’ pork. It was tender and meaty, a substantial dish. My informal poll of fellow food geeks out on the town that night agreed that this was the hands-down favorite.
